Botox (Botulinum toxin) is commonly used to treat various medical conditions, including muscle contractility disorders.
Muscle Relaxation: Botox works by blocking signals from the nerves to the muscles, preventing muscle contractions. This property can be particularly beneficial in conditions where excessive muscle contraction causes discomfort or functional impairment.
Pain Relief: In conditions such as muscle spasms or dystonia, where sustained muscle contractions lead to pain, Botox injections can provide relief by reducing muscle activity and alleviating associated discomfort.
Improved Functionality: By relaxing overactive muscles, Botox injections can improve movement and functionality in affected areas. This is particularly useful in conditions like cerebral palsy or spasticity following stroke, where muscle stiffness and contractility can significantly impair mobility.
Management of Spasticity: Botox injections can effectively manage spasticity, a condition characterized by stiff, tight muscles and exaggerated reflexes. By targeting specific muscle groups, Botox can help reduce spasticity and improve range of motion.
Non-invasive Treatment Option: Botox injections are minimally invasive and can often be administered in an outpatient setting. This makes it a convenient option for patients who prefer non-surgical treatments or those who are not suitable candidates for surgery.
Customized Treatment: Botox injections can be tailored to target specific muscle groups, allowing for a customized treatment approach based on the individual's condition and symptoms. This flexibility enables healthcare providers to optimize treatment outcomes and minimize side effects.
Long-lasting Effects: While the duration of effectiveness can vary depending on the condition being treated, Botox injections typically provide relief for several months. This prolonged duration of action can result in sustained improvement in symptoms and quality of life for patients.
Minimal Side Effects: When administered by a trained healthcare professional, Botox injections are generally safe and well-tolerated. Common side effects such as temporary bruising or mild discomfort at the injection site are usually transient and resolve quickly.
Adjunct to Therapy: Botox treatment can be used in conjunction with other therapeutic interventions such as physical therapy or occupational therapy to maximize functional outcomes. This multidisciplinary approach can enhance the overall effectiveness of treatment and promote long-term rehabilitation.
